How to Repair Minor Scratches on Headlights?

I've seen this quite a few times – minor scratches on car headlights. Polishing is a reliable method. First, wipe the surface clean with a soft cloth to remove dust, then apply some specialized polishing compound. Use a small circular pad or manually buff in small circles with gentle pressure to avoid creating deeper marks. If you don't have professional tools, car wax from home can serve as a temporary solution, though the effect won't be as good. Remember to apply a protective layer afterward, like a UV-resistant spray, to minimize future oxidation issues. DIY repairs save money and avoid the hassle of queuing at repair shops. The key is to act quickly to prevent scratches from worsening, which could affect headlight brightness and driving safety. During regular car washes, use soft cloths and avoid hard objects to prevent new scratches – proper maintenance makes headlights more durable.

Why Does the Car Brake Make Abnormal Noises?

Car brakes make abnormal noises mainly due to the following reasons: 1. Use of low-quality or overly hard brake pads. If inferior or excessively hard brake pads are used, they will produce abnormal noises when rubbing against the brake discs during braking. 2. Presence of sand or foreign objects between the brake pads and discs. Due to the unique design of disc brakes, some sand or foreign objects may inevitably get between the brake pads and discs, causing abnormal noises during braking. 3. Severe wear of the brake discs. Using low-quality brake pads or having hard foreign objects between the brake pads and discs can lead to abnormal wear of the brake discs. 4. Brake pad warning. Some brake pads come with electronic warnings, while lower-end vehicles may use warning tabs. If the wear on the brake pads reaches the warning line, abnormal noises will be produced.

Does a small scratch on the tire have any impact?

Generally, a small scratch on the sidewall of a tire does not affect its use. However, if a layer of rubber is missing, it is not recommended to continue using it. The rubber on the sidewall of a tire is very thin and can easily burst from the damaged area, and it cannot be repaired because repairing requires grinding away part of the rubber, making it even thinner. Most repair shops do not repair tire sidewalls and usually recommend replacement. Additional information: Car tires are one of the important components of a vehicle. Why is the car steering wheel a bit stiff?

There are several main reasons why a car's steering wheel may feel stiff: 1. For hydraulic power steering systems, the common cause is dirty power steering fluid. This situation is similar to how dirty engine oil affects engine power and performance. 2. For electric power steering systems, you should check whether the fuse is blown, or if there are any open circuits or short circuits to ground in the wiring. 3. With electric power steering, repeatedly turning the steering wheel while stationary or at low speeds puts extreme load on the power steering system, which can easily cause the steering gear to overheat and enter protection mode, resulting in heavy steering. This will return to normal after cooling down, which is a normal phenomenon. 4. Insufficient tire pressure can also make the driver feel the steering wheel become noticeably heavier. Simply inflating the tires to standard pressure will restore normal operation.
